Michelle Yeoh Joyfully Announces New Family Addition: 'A Little Miracle'

Michelle Yeoh

Michelle Yeoh has a new role in life: She's a grandma!

The Everything Everywhere All At Once actress took to Instagram during the early morning hours of Tuesday, Jan. 2, to share that her family had added an adorable new addition just the day prior.

Her first post confused fans, who thought she may have welcomed the baby herself, as she shared just a simple snap of the newborn's foot alongside a rather vague caption. "A little miracle on the first day of 2024 ❤️✨ we are so truly blessed…" the 61-year-old wrote. "Can’t tell u how happy I am for this very very special bundle of joy ❤️✨."

Hours later, Yeoh followed up with a second upload to the picture-sharing platform, confirming that the "little miracle" is actually her grandchild.

"Thank you darling Nicolas and Darina for making us the happiest and proudest Grandparents!!" the Crouching Tiger, Hidden Dragon alum gushed. "Welcome baby Maxime ❤️💖✨❤️💖✨."

Along with the cheery sentiment–and clarification–Yeoh shared two new photos of herself looking absolutely radiant and overjoyed with her husband, Jean Todt.
